Ben Silby has delivered something truly special with “can’t hang”—a debut album that balances clever lyricism with deep emotional resonance. It’s a record made for anyone who’s ever loved too hard, texted too late, or struggled to find where they fit. In just eight tracks, Silby manages to capture an entire spectrum of queer experience with bold vulnerability and sharp pop instincts.
Tracks like “wavy” and “my bad” are instant favorites—offering a mix of groove and gloom that invites repeat listens. Meanwhile, the minimalist “interlude” and theremin-laced “dirt ii” showcase Silby’s fearless experimentation, weaving sonic surprise into the emotional core. It’s a collection of songs that feel lived-in, like pages torn from a beautifully messy diary.
What truly sets this album apart is Silby’s voice—both literally and metaphorically. Their storytelling is raw, poetic, and never afraid to be both funny and devastating in the same breath. “can’t hang” isn’t just an introduction to an artist—it’s an invitation into their world, and you’ll be glad you accepted.
